Problem

Energy storage systems experience electric energy quality fluctuations during on-grid and off-grid switching, leading to potential load tripping or device damage.

Innovation Solution

A method and device for on-grid and off-grid dispatch that determines given power and voltage based on previous load conditions, adjusts energy storage converter output parameters using direct-axis and quadrature-axis voltage adjustment parameters, and performs proportional integral adjustments to maintain seamless transitions.

AI summary

A method and a device for on-grid and off-grid dispatch, and an energy storage air-conditioning system are provided. The method for on-grid and off-grid dispatch includes: causing a load to be off-grid and causing an energy storage converter to supply power to the load after determining that grid is down; determining a given power and a given voltage according to a voltage and a current of the load obtained for the last time before the grid is down; and obtaining an actual voltage and an actual current outputted by the energy storage converter; and adjusting an output parameter of the energy storage converter according to the given power and the given voltage, as well as the actual voltage and the actual current outputted by the energy storage converter.
